Curriculum Structure

In your first year, you will build a rock-solid foundation in the pillars of commerce, ensuring you have the breadth of knowledge needed for any business environment. You’ll dive into core units like Introduction to Financial Accounting and Microeconomics, while also mastering the digital side with Data Analytics for Business to ensure your tech skills are sharp from day one.

As you move into year two, the focus shifts toward more complex organizational dynamics and specialized economic theory. You will explore modules such as Macroeconomics and Probability & Operations Management, while beginning to hone your professional edge through dedicated Career Development Skills sessions that prepare you for the competitive landscape ahead.

Year three is where your classroom learning meets the real world through a significant focus on professional application and advanced analysis. You’ll be tackling Financial Markets & Institutions and have the opportunity to engage in a Financial Data Analysis project, all while preparing for or returning from your immersive six-month industry placement.

Finally, in year four, you’ll step into a leadership mindset, synthesizing everything you’ve learned to solve high-level strategic challenges. Your studies will culminate in sophisticated units like Financial Economics and Economic Policy Issues, where you’ll test theories against contemporary global events like crypto-currency shifts and international trade crises.

Focus areas: Investment Principles, Macroeconomic Policy, Data Analytics, Financial Modelling, and Corporate Finance.

Learning outcomes: Graduates will be able to perform complex financial forecasting, evaluate the impact of global economic policy, utilize advanced data visualization tools, and apply ethical frameworks to corporate decision-making.

Professional alignment (accreditation): This degree is specifically designed around the Qualified Financial Advisor (QFA) qualification, providing graduates with significant exemptions and a direct pathway to becoming a certified professional in the Irish and international financial services sectors.

Experiential Learning (Research, Projects, Internships etc.)

One of the best things about the Bachelor of Business (Honours) in Finance and Economics at ATU is that we don’t just expect you to read about the markets—we want you to be in them. We’ve designed this program so that by the time you graduate, you’ve already handled real-world financial data and solved complex economic problems using the exact same tools the pros use.

You’ll spend a huge portion of your time in our dedicated computer labs, moving beyond theory to master the digital "language" of finance. Whether it's building intricate forecasting models or working through a high-stakes group simulation, the focus is always on giving you the "muscle memory" needed for a fast-paced corporate environment. This practical approach is fully supported by our unique "Learning-by-Doing" philosophy:

  • Professional Work Placement: A massive highlight is the three-to-six-month accredited work placement in Year 3. You’ll be embedded with industry leaders like KPMG, State Street, or Irish Life, gaining that "day-one" experience that makes your CV stand out.

  • Specialized Software Suite: You won't just be using basic tools; you’ll become a power user in Microsoft Excel for Financial Modelling, and you’ll dive into R (programming language) for statistical analysis and data visualization.

  • Industry-Standard Analytics: You will utilize Business Intelligence (BI) tools and SQL for database management, ensuring you can extract and interpret the "big data" that drives global economic decisions.

  • Collaborative Group Projects: Many modules, such as Management: Enterprise and Society, are built around team-based simulations where you’ll act as consultants to solve real business bottlenecks.

  • The iHubs & Research Centers: You’ll have access to our Innovation Hubs (iHubs), where start-ups are born right on campus. It’s a fantastic place to network with entrepreneurs and see "Economic Development" in action.

  • Digital Learning Environments: Through our IT Centre, which boasts over 180 workstations and high-speed multimedia studios, you’ll have the hardware to run complex regression analyses and time-series modeling without a hitch.

  • Library & Research Facilities: Our award-winning campus libraries offer much more than books; they provide specialized financial databases and quiet research pods specifically for your final-year dissertation work.
